Why Declutter Effectively Before Moving?
Decluttering before a move is essential. It lightens your load, making packing and unpacking easier. When you declutter effectively, you avoid transporting unnecessary items that take up space and add to moving costs. It also helps you start fresh in your new home with only the things you truly need and love.
Here are some benefits of decluttering before moving:
Saves money: Fewer items mean lower moving fees.
Saves time: Less packing and unpacking.
Reduces stress: A cleaner, more organized space feels less chaotic.
Helps with organization: You can categorize items and plan your new space better.
Decluttering is not just about throwing things away. It’s about making thoughtful decisions on what adds value to your life and what doesn’t.

How to Declutter Effectively: Step-by-Step Guide
Decluttering can feel overwhelming, but breaking it down into manageable steps makes it easier. Follow this step-by-step guide to declutter effectively before your move:
1. Start Early and Plan
Begin decluttering weeks before your move. Create a schedule and set daily or weekly goals. This prevents last-minute panic and rushed decisions.
2. Sort by Categories
Instead of tackling the whole house at once, sort items by category:
Clothes
Books
Kitchenware
Electronics
Furniture
Sentimental items
This method helps you focus and make better decisions.
3. Use the Four-Box Method
Label four boxes or bins as:
Keep
Donate
Sell
Trash
As you go through each category, place items into the appropriate box. Be honest with yourself about what you really need.
4. Ask Key Questions
When deciding what to keep, ask:
Have I used this in the last year?
Does it fit my current lifestyle?
Is it broken or damaged?
Does it hold sentimental value?
If the answer is no to most questions, it’s time to let it go.
5. Donate and Sell
Items in good condition can be donated to local charities or sold online. This reduces waste and can even earn you some extra cash.
6. Dispose Responsibly
For items that cannot be donated or sold, dispose of them responsibly. Check local regulations for hazardous waste or electronics recycling.
7. Pack Smart
Once you have your “keep” items, pack them efficiently. Use quality boxes, label everything clearly, and pack heavier items at the bottom.

Tips to Streamline Your Move
Besides decluttering, there are other ways to make your move smoother and more efficient.
1. Hire Professional Movers
Professional movers have the experience and equipment to handle your belongings safely and quickly. They can also provide packing services if needed.
2. Use Quality Packing Materials
Invest in sturdy boxes, bubble wrap, packing paper, and tape. Proper packing protects your items and makes unpacking easier.
3. Label Everything Clearly
Label boxes with their contents and the room they belong to. This helps movers place boxes in the right rooms and speeds up unpacking.
4. Pack an Essentials Box
Prepare a box with essentials like toiletries, a change of clothes, important documents, and basic kitchen items. Keep this box accessible during the move.
5. Notify Important Parties
Update your address with the post office, banks, utilities, and any subscriptions. This prevents disruptions and lost mail.
6. Use a Moving Checklist
Create a checklist to track tasks and deadlines. This keeps you organized and ensures nothing is forgotten.

Maintaining a Clutter-Free Home After Moving
Once you’ve moved and decluttered, it’s important to maintain a clutter-free environment. Here are some tips to keep your new home organized:
Regularly review your belongings: Every few months, assess what you use and what you don’t.
Adopt a one-in, one-out rule: For every new item you bring in, remove one old item.
Create designated storage spaces: Use shelves, bins, and organizers to keep things tidy.
Avoid impulse purchases: Think carefully before buying new items.
Schedule periodic decluttering sessions: Set reminders to declutter seasonally.
By staying mindful of your possessions, you can enjoy a clean, organized living space that feels comfortable and welcoming.
